Abstract: Long span ultra-high voltage (UHV) transmission lines have serious aeolian vibration problems. To control these
vibrations, we improved the energy balance method in the following aspects: the wind power input, the conductor self-damping,
and the damper dissipated power. Meanwhile, we built a theoretical mechanical model of wire dampers and derived energy
dissipation calculation formulae. This permits the vibration energy dissipated by wire dampers can be considered in the energy
balance method. Then, we developed a computer program based on the improved energy balance method using Matlab, and
analyzed UHV long span ground wires of the Han River long span project in P. R. China. The results show that the combination
of wire dampers and Stockbridge dampers can reduce vibration of UHV long span transmission lines, which provides a
reference for research and construction of UHV engineering projects.
Keywords: ultra-high voltage transmission lines; aeolian vibration; energy balance method; Stockbridge dampers; wire
dampers
